Methods of Calibration We are attempting to calibrate the detector using a calibrated source (±5%). We confirmed the source’s calibration with: Proportional Counter PIN Diode

Problems with the Proportional Counter Obscure geometry of detector Pressure problems (P-10 Gas) Solid angle problems (measuring the depth of the window)

Increasing the Signal to Noise Von Hamos spectrometer disperses according to wavelength. With the energy calibration, background counts can be eliminated.
